Help Participants
Weather Market Volatility

Mutual of Omaha

Today's turbulent market can rattle the confidence of any participant, particularly the less savvy investors. After all, they're working hard to make retirement savings part of an already stretched budget. That's where you can help.

Participants may look to you for guidance, so encourage them to stay the course through market shifts. Here are a few strategies you can suggest to help them think long-term:


  • Maintain a diverse portfolio – Spread money over several different types of investments so if one type of investment declines in value, the overall impact on the portfolio may be limited
  • Don't try to "time" the market – Regular investing through automatic payroll deductions helps participants avoid the temptation to wait for the "perfect" time to invest, which puts them at risk of investing all their money at the top of the market when it's most expensive
  • Consider the historical returns of various investments – Generally stocks have shown the highest rate of return over time, but this is an average based on years of performance data
